What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ote health insurance spec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Health Insurance Specialist, you need a solid understanding of health insurance policies, claims processing, and regulatory compliance, often supported by a relevant degree or insurance license. Familiarity with CRM software, claims management systems, and digital communication tools is typically required. Strong attention to detail, problem-solving skills, and effective virtual communication set top performers apart. These skills ensure accurate claim handling, regulatory adherence, and excellent customer service in a remote work environment.

What are some common challenges of working in a remote health insurance role, and how can they be managed?

A common challenge in remote health insurance roles is maintaining effective communication with both clients and team members, as much of the work relies on virtual interactions. To manage this, professionals often use secure digital platforms and regularly scheduled video meetings to stay connected. Another challenge is staying updated with changing regulations and insurance policies, which requires proactive participation in ongoing training and close collaboration with compliance teams. Time management and self-motivation are also crucial, as remote work requires balancing multiple tasks independently throughout the day.

Remote Health Insurance professionals focus on selling, managing, or advising on health insurance policies, often requiring licensing and industry knowledge. Remote Medical Claims Processors handle the review and processing of medical claims, typically needing billing certifications. Both roles are home-based and serve the healthcare and insurance sectors, but they differ in responsibilities and credentials.

What are remote health insurance jobs?

Remote health insurance jobs involve working in sales or providing customer service to policy-holders. As a work-from-home insurance agent, you sell healthcare policies to customers. You communicate with each customer by phone or internet to define their coverage needs, then help them select an insurance plan that has the benefits to meet those needs. Your duties can include assisting clients as they complete paperwork to obtain coverage and answering questions from new or existing policy-holders.
